Holloway scores 27; Lady Canes lose thriller by two

SAINT LEO, Fla. - The Saint Leo women's basketball team defeated Georgia Southwestern, 77-75, on the opening night of the Sleep Inn Classic, Friday evening from the Marion Bowman Activities Center.

In the first half, both teams matched each other in intensity, and through the first 10 minutes of the initial period, the score remained close with SLU holding a slight 22-20 advantage. Saint Leo, who opened the regular season with a win at Division I Stetson, went on a 10-5 run to increase their lead to seven and held that advantage into the break.

GSW went on a 16-4 run to start the second half; eventually gaining a five point advantage with 12:02 left in regulation. SLU answered with five straight points to even the score at 53. The back and forth tussle continued until it appeared the Lady Hurricanes gained control of the contest with a 10-1 run in a three minute time span, sparked by eight consecutive points from Kanita Holloway.

Despite a 63-54 lead by the Lady 'Canes, the Lions went on a 12-4 run to regain a one-point lead with 2:59 to play. SLU stretched the lead to three on a basket a few moments later. Jonneshia Pineda evened the score for GSW at 71 apiece with 1:12 left when she connected on the first of two free throws, but that was as close as Southwestern would get as Saint Leo scored six of the final 10 points to lock up the testy, hard-fought game.

Holloway connected on 8-of-12 from the floor and led all players with 27 points. Brittany Reynolds posted her eighth career double-double with 10 points and a game-high 11 rebounds. Brandi Burris added 12 points and pulled down seven boards.

Saint Leo had four players score in double figures, including 15 points by Willonda Windham. Lauren Lee added 14 points and nine rebounds. Sierra Williams chipped in 12 points and five rebounds, while Dominique Daniels contributed 11 points and five boards.

As a team, the Lions held a slim advantage from the floor, outshooting the Hurricanes 40.0 % (26-for-65) to 39.1 % (25-for-64). GSW outrebounded Saint Leo, 51-46.

Southwestern returns to action Saturday against Florida Southern on the second day of the Sleep Inn Classic. Tip-off is set for 5:30 p.m.
